What Are Intermodal Containers?
An intermodal container, typically referred to as a shipping container, is a standardized container designed for carrying products throughout different modes of transport-- such as ships, trains, and trucks-- without the need for filling and dumping the contents. These containers can be sealed for security and are built to hold up against various environmental conditions.

Intermodal containers can be found in various types, each created for particular cargo needs. Below is a table summing up the most typical types:
Container TypeDescriptionTypical UsesDry Storage ContainerBasic container used for basic cargo.Durable goods, electronics.Reefer ContainerRefrigerated container used to transport disposable products.Foodstuff, pharmaceuticals.Open Top ContainerContainer with a detachable top for loading oversized cargo.Heavy machinery, large equipment.Flat Rack ContainerA container without any side walls, appropriate for holding big and heavy cargo.Cars, heavy machinery.Tank ContainerA container developed for transferring liquids and gases.Chemicals, fuels.High Cube ContainerSimilar to standard containers however taller, permitting for more cargo capacity.Bulky products, additional goods.Advantages of Using Intermodal Containers

What are the standard dimensions of intermodal containers?
The most typical dimensions are:
20 feet (length) x 8 feet (width) x 8.5 feet (height)40 feet (length) x 8 feet (width) x 8.5 feet (height)High cube containers generally have a height of 9.5 feet.2. How are intermodal containers transferred?
